Sam Bankman-Fried is scheduled to fly once more to the US from a enterprise airport inside the Bahamas on Wednesday. According to Bloomberg.
Bloomberg reported that the FTX co-founder signed the quit doc on Tuesday, citing Doan Clearer, deputy for the Bahamas’ Corrections Charge.Bankman-Fried will sign the last word papers. wield the right to fight extradition in courtroom docket inside the Bahamas on Wednesday.
Bankman-Fried Bahamian Authorized skilled Jerone Roberts, To reporters, his client voluntarily agreeing to extradition, ignoring “the strongest potential approved advice”; per New York Times.
The selection was reportedly based totally on Bankman-Fried’s grant bail under house arrest within the US. He was denied bail at a courtroom docket listening to remaining week, in response to Bloomberg.
Bankman-Fried will doubtless be escorted by FBI brokers on a non-commercial flight to the US, Bloomberg reported, citing sources accustomed to the matter.
The disgraceful ex-crypto boss indicted on eight countsalong with wire fraud.
US federal prosecutors have accused Bankman-Fried of misappropriating funds from FTX prospects. repay a loan owed by Alameda ResearchA separate agency owned by Bankman-Fried. Prosecutors have moreover accused the FTX co-founder of defrauding lenders.
Bankman-Fried has denied knowingly committing fraud in numerous newest interviews.
on monday, he appeared in court in Nassau, the capital of the Bahamas.Spherical Reutershe wanted to be wakened by courtroom docket officers after closing his eyes on the extradition listening to.
